Objective: This study aims to examine the role of parent-teacher cooperation in enhancing student development, focusing on how effective communication, parental involvement, and high levels of collaboration positively impact students' academic and personal growth. Methods: A qualitative approach was used, involving 200 participants, including teachers, parents, and students. Data were collected through surveys, interviews, and focus group discussions. Thematic analysis and basic statistical methods were applied to analyze the data, with ethical considerations prioritized throughout. Results: The study found that targeted communication between parents and teachers significantly improved students' academic success and personal development. Parental involvement in the educational process led to better academic performance, enhanced social skills, and a positive attitude toward school. High levels of cooperation resulted in improved academic achievement and strengthened personal and social skills in students. Novelty: This study highlights the importance of structured parent-teacher partnerships, offering insights into how effective communication and involvement can foster not only academic success but also the holistic development of students, contributing to improved education within communities.
